Understanding Cam Phasers
Cam phasers are devices that adjust the timing of the camshaft in relation to the crankshaft. This adjustment allows for better performance and fuel efficiency by optimizing the engine’s power output at different RPMs. In Ford vehicles, particularly those with the Modular engine family, cam phasers are designed to enhance performance but have been known to experience issues.
Common Cam Phaser Issues
Several issues have been reported by Ford owners regarding cam phasers. Understanding these problems can help in identifying potential concerns before they escalate.
- Timing Chain Noise: A common symptom is a rattling noise from the engine, especially at startup. This can indicate that the cam phasers are failing to adjust properly.
- Check Engine Light: Many owners report that a malfunctioning cam phaser triggers the check engine light, often accompanied by diagnostic trouble codes related to timing issues.
- Reduced Performance: Poor acceleration and overall reduced engine performance can be linked to cam phaser malfunctions, affecting the driving experience.
- Oil Pressure Issues: Cam phasers rely on oil pressure for operation. If there are oil flow issues, the phasers may not function correctly, leading to further complications.

Preventive Measures
Preventing cam phaser issues involves proactive maintenance and awareness of the vehicle’s performance. Here are some preventive measures that can be taken:
- Regular Oil Changes: Keeping the engine oil clean and at the proper level ensures that cam phasers receive adequate lubrication and pressure.
- Listen for Unusual Noises: Being attentive to any changes in engine noise can help catch issues early before they escalate.
- Use Quality Parts: If replacement parts are needed, using high-quality, OEM components can help maintain engine integrity.
